The Washington Redskins officially re-signed DE Frank Kearse on Monday, according to the NFL transactions release.
This comes just a few days after the team released him in order to free up a roster spot for OLB Houston Bates, who was signed from their practice squad.
Kearse, 26, is a former seventh-round pick of the Dolphins back in 2011. However, he lasted just a few months in Miami before he later signed on with the Panthers.
Since then, Kearse has played for the Titans and Cowboys before joining the Redskins on a one-year contract back in May.
In 2014, Kearse appeared in 15 games for the Redskins and recorded 15 tackles and three sacks.
